Automatización en la Nube: Optimiza Recursos y Reduce Costos Eficazmente
La computación en la nube ha revolucionado la manera en la que empresas de todos los tamaños gestionan sus operaciones tecnológicas. Sin embargo, la adopción de la nube por sí sola no garantiza eficiencia ni ahorro. Aquí es donde la automatización en la nube marca la diferencia: permite a las organizaciones optimizar recursos, responder rápidamente a las demandas del mercado y reducir significativamente los costos operativos.
¿Te gustaría saber cómo la automatización en la nube puede convertirse en la clave para tu éxito digital? En este artículo descubrirás sus ventajas principales, las mejores prácticas y ejemplos claros para lograr una infraestructura ágil, rentable y preparada para el futuro.
¿Qué es la automatización en la computación en la nube?
La automatización en la nube consiste en el uso de herramientas, scripts y procesos automáticos para gestionar, aprovisionar y monitorizar recursos cloud. Esto incluye tareas como la creación de máquinas virtuales, la asignación de almacenamiento, la actualización de aplicaciones y el escalado de servicios, todo realizado sin intervención manual.
La automatización te permite minimizar errores humanos, acelerar procesos y liberar a tu equipo para que se concentre en tareas estratégicas.
Ventajas clave de la automatización en la nube
1. Optimización del uso de recursos
- Aprovisionamiento dinámico: Los recursos se asignan y ajustan automáticamente según la demanda, evitando el desperdicio o la escasez.
- Escalabilidad eficiente: Se amplían o reducen instancias, almacenamiento o bases de datos según el tráfico o las necesidades del negocio.
2. Reducción de costos operativos
La automatización ayuda a:
- Apagar recursos inactivos fuera del horario laboral.
- Aprovechar instancias reservadas o de bajo costo según las cargas de trabajo.
- Prevenir gastos por sobreaprovisionamiento.
3. Mejor disponibilidad y continuidad del negocio
- Detecta y repara fallos automáticamente.
- Realiza copias de seguridad y recuperaciones de manera programada.
- Reduce el tiempo de inactividad por errores humanos.
4. Mayor velocidad y agilidad
- Los desarrolladores pueden desplegar entornos completos en minutos.
- El time-to-market de nuevos productos o servicios se reduce.
- Respondes en tiempo real a cambios de demanda u optimización.
5. Seguridad y cumplimiento automatizados
- Configura reglas automáticas que verifiquen el cumplimiento de normativas.
- Aplica parches y actualizaciones de seguridad sin demora.
Principales áreas de automatización en la nube
a) Infraestructura como código (IaC)
Herramientas como Terraform, AWS CloudFormation o Azure Resource Manager permiten definir y gestionar toda la infraestructura a través de archivos de configuración, garantizando despliegues consistentes y repetibles.
b) Orquestación y gestión de contenedores
Automatiza la creación, escalado y administración de aplicaciones basadas en contenedores con plataformas como Kubernetes o Docker Swarm.
c) Monitorización y reacción automática
Implementa sistemas de monitoreo proactivo que desencadenan acciones (escalado, reinicio de servicios, alertas) ante eventos o métricas críticas.
d) Despliegue continuo (CI/CD)
Automatiza pruebas, integración y despliegue de código con pipelines que aceleran la entrega, mejoran la calidad y reducen fallos.
e) Copias de seguridad y recuperación ante desastres
Programa backups automáticos y restauraciones rápidas ante incidentes, garantizando disponibilidad y protección de datos.
Mejores prácticas para implementar automatización en la nube
- Evalúa procesos repetitivos: Identifica tareas que consumen tiempo y pueden beneficiarse de la automatización.
- Utiliza plantillas y scripts reutilizables: Estandariza la creación de recursos para minimizar errores.
- Establece políticas de gobernanza: Define reglas claras para el uso de recursos, acceso y seguridad.
- Monitorea y ajusta continuamente: La nube es dinámica, revisa métricas y adapta automatizaciones a nuevos escenarios.
- Capacita a tu equipo: Invierte en formación para sacar el máximo rendimiento a las herramientas de automatización.
Ejemplos prácticos de automatización en la nube
- Autoescalado de servidores web ante picos de tráfico.
- Eliminación automática de snapshots antiguos para ahorrar espacio y costos.
- Despliegue de entornos de testing bajo demanda y su eliminación tras finalizar las pruebas.
- Rotación automática de claves y contraseñas para maximizar la seguridad.
- Reporte automatizado de consumo y alertas de excesos presupuestarios.
Retos y consideraciones al automatizar en la nube
- Complejidad inicial: La configuración requiere planificación y pruebas, pero su retorno es alto.
- Sobrecarga de automatización: Automatizar todo sin control puede generar incidencias difíciles de rastrear.
- Dependencia de proveedores: Evalúa la portabilidad de tus automatizaciones entre distintas plataformas.
Futuro de la automatización en la nube
La tendencia es una nube cada vez más autónoma. El aprendizaje automático y la inteligencia artificial comienzan a integrarse para optimizar recursos de manera predictiva, ajustar cargas de trabajo en tiempo real y prevenir incidencias antes de que ocurran.
Las empresas que adopten la automatización en la nube estarán mejor posicionadas para innovar, crecer y reducir costos de forma sostenible.
Conclusión
La automatización en la nube es más que una opción: es el camino para llevar la gestión de recursos tecnológicos a otro nivel. Permite optimizar, ahorrar y responder con agilidad a las exigencias del mercado digital actual.
Ahora que conoces las ventajas, aplicaciones y mejores prácticas, ¿estás listo para dar el siguiente paso? Evalúa tus procesos, adopta herramientas líderes y haz de la automatización en la nube tu mejor aliada para el éxito empresarial.